Frequently Asked Questions about Aurora
How much are Studio apartments in Aurora?
There are currently 317 Studio Apartments in Aurora with rent ranges from $772 to $2,339 with an average price of $1,304.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Aurora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Aurora ranges from $799 to $8,203 with an average monthly rent of $1,567.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Aurora c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Aurora range from $1,049 to $7,868.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,010.
How expensive are Aurora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 290 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Aurora on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$775 to $20,899 - averaging $2,726 for the location.
